Abstract
Objective Down regulating the expression of survivin mRNA and survivinprotein in the human bleed urothelial carcinoma cell line (T24) to observe its affect to the proliferation and apoptosis of T24 cells.Methods The eukaryotic expression plasmids targeting survivin [psilencer-survivin-small interfering RNA (siRNA),si-Sl,si-S2,si-S3] and negative control plasmid (psilencer-random target sequence-siRNA,si-GL3) were constructed simultaneously,and transfected these plasmids to T24 cells.The expression of survivin mRNA and survivin protein were detected by real-time reverse transcriptase-polymerase chain reaction (RT-qPCR) and Western blotting; the vitality of T24 cells was examined by cell counting kit-8 (CCK-8) assay; the apoptosis of T24 cells were tested by flow cytometry; the Caspase-3 activity was detected by specific colour test.Results In si-S3 treatment,the expression of survivin mRNA and survivin protein decreased significantly 79% and 80%,cytoactivity declined with depended time and concentration,cell apoptosis increased 20.96% with increased 85% Caspase-3 activity,as compared with the control group (every P < 0.05).Conclusion Downregulating survivin could effectively inhibit the proliferation and induce apoptosis of T24cells,which mechanism may be active Caspase-3 in T24 cells.
